Basketball WA Opens Recreation Centre in Shark Bay

Basketball WA were recently invited to Shark Bay to help celebrate the opening of their new Community, Sport and Recreation Centre, which will give the community access to sport and recreational activities in a new fantastic facility.

Basketball WA was represented by 7 SBL players who worked within the local community at the local school and also hosted coaching clinics for the local children and adults. The clinics were a great way for the community to get a better understanding of structured basketball drills and also for them to engage with the players and ask any questions on basketball. The opening of the recreation centre was a massive success with a great turnout and support from the local community. The highlight for many was the exhibition match between the SBL players and then inviting the local community to play alongside them, the Shire of Shark Bay definitely gave our SBL players a good run for their money!

The weekend also played host to the Gascoyne Games, which our SBL players helped coach the teams and referee. It was a fantastic tournament, with representation from all over the Shire along with players from Carnarvon attending to play in the games. The standard of basketball was very high, with some close competitive games and slam dunk competitions held throughout the day!
